What Is Laravel?
Web developers are equipped with a wide range of tools and resources thanks to Laravel, a PHP framework that is dynamic and open source, making it easier to build modern, reliable web applications that are built on PHP.

Is Laravel Front End Or Back End?
A well-known PHP-based back-end framework is Laravel. It offers the fundamental components needed to create cutting-edge, scalable online applications. These functions, which concentrate on the server-side elements of application development, include routing, validation, and file storage.

Benefits of Laravel
Due to its robust features and simplicity of use, Laravel has grown significantly in popularity among web developers since its initial release in 2011 and following growth with Laravel 3 in 2012. Here are some of Laravel's main advantages:

  1. Model-View-Controller (MVC) Architecture: Laravel uses the MVC architectural pattern, which provides an organised method for creating scalable and maintainable online applications. This pattern offers rules for efficiently organising code.

  2. Artisan CLI: Using the Artisan Command-Line Interface (CLI), developers may more quickly do activities like database maintenance, data migration, and code development. By streamlining common development procedures, Artisan frees up developers to concentrate on creating application logic.

  3. Built-in Authentication: With the help of a few Artisan commands, Laravel's built-in authentication and authorization solutions make it simple to quickly set up reliable security measures. For web applications, this functionality guarantees trustworthy user authentication.

  4. Blade Template Engine: The Blade Template Engine, a potent tool for tying together data models and executing application code inside template tags, is a component of Laravel. Blade increases the effectiveness of work by enabling developers to direct output to other locations, such as text files or streams.

  5. Eloquent ORM: Eloquent is an Object-Relational Mapper (ORM) that streamlines Laravel's database interaction. Every database table has a corresponding Eloquent model, making it simple to retrieve, insert, update, and delete data.

  6. Support for Redis: Redis is a flexible key-value store that also serves as a data structure server, and Laravel allows for its integration. Redis acts as a cache for short-term data storage, speeding up database queries and improving the performance of the entire application.

Due to the combination of these qualities, Laravel is a popular framework among developers because it is both appealing and effective for creating web applications.
